Apple brownies
Ingredients/Components
- cinnamon - 1 tsp
- vanilla - 2 tsp
- granulated sugar - 2 c
- salt - 1 tsp
- oil
- baking soda - 1 tsp
- all-purpose flour - 3 c
- large eggs - 3 item
- raisins - 3/4 c
- nuts, chopped - 1 c
- Granny Smith apples, chopped - 3 c
How to make apple brownies:
Heat oven to 350°. Grease a 15 1/2 x 10 1/2-inch jelly roll pan. Mix flour, baking soda, salt and cinnamon in a large bowl. Whisk oil and eggs in another bowl until blended and smooth. Stir in sugar and vanilla. Stir in flour mixture until blended. Stir in apples, nuts and raisins. Spread evenly in pan. Bake 40 to 50 minutes until top is golden. Let cool on wire rack. Dust with powdered sugar.Recipe categories: Cookie and brownie, Bar cookie, Brownies.
